Scott fitzgerald's short story bernice bobs her hair first appeared in the saturday evening post in may of 1920 and subsequently in his first short story collection, flappers and philosophers, later that same year. Bernice bobs her hair takes place at the dawn of the jazz age and revolves around a girl from the countryside, the titular bernice, who goes to stay with her cousin marjorie in the big city.
